Biography
Jacob Basil Anderson, born on June 18, 1990, in Bristol, England, is a British actor and musician. He is widely recognized for his role as Grey Worm in the acclaimed television series Game of Thrones. Anderson has also appeared in other notable productions, such as Broadchurch, Episodes, and the AMC series Interview with the Vampire, where he portrays Louis de Pointe du Lac. In addition to his acting career, Anderson is a musician who performs under the alias Raleigh Ritchie, inspired by characters from The Royal Tenenbaums. His music blends genres like soul, trip-hop, and alternative R&B. His debut album, You're a Man Now, Boy, was released in 2016 to positive reviews, followed by his second album, Andy, in 2020.
